2,440 research outputs found

    An XML-based Multimedia Middleware for Mobile Online Auctions

    Get PDF
    Pervasive Internet services today promise to provide users with a quick and convenient access to a variety of commercial applications. However, due to unsuitable architectures and poor performance user acceptance is still low. To be a major success mobile services have to provide device-adapted content and advanced value-added Web services. Innovative enabling technologies like XML and wireless communication may for the first time provide a facility to interact with online applications anytime anywhere. We present a prototype implementing an efficient multimedia middleware approach towards ubiquitous value-added services using an auction house as a sample application. Advanced multi-feature retrieval technologies are combined with enhanced content delivery to show the impact of modern enterprise information systems on today’s e-commerce applications

    Weather Information System for Farmers Based on WAP Technology

    Get PDF
    The WAP application is an application that is accessed via mobile device over a wireless network; this technology has been rapidly growing and distributed in different environments and has basically affected our lives directly and indirectly. This study carried out an investigation into the Weather Information System for Farmers based on WAP Technology to simplify the weather queries via the mobile device. Furthermore the proposed application would be able to save the time and effort of the farmers in checking the required weather changes. The WAP Weather Information System was developed based on WML and ASP mobile programming architecture; furthermore, the usability testing results were obtained to determine the system usefulness. Finally, the WAP Weather Information System may help the farmers by providing them with useful functions, such as weather news, product price, and local news

    Digital Triplet Approach for Real-Time Monitoring and Control of an Elevator Security System

    Get PDF
    As Digital Twins gain more traction and their adoption in industry increases, there is a need to integrate such technology with machine learning features to enhance functionality and enable decision making tasks. This has lead to the emergence of a concept known as Digital Triplet; an enhancement of Digital Twin technology through the addition of an ’intelligent activity layer’. This is a relatively new technology in Industrie 4.0 and research efforts are geared towards exploring its applicability, development and testing of means for implementation and quick adoption. This paper presents the design and implementation of a Digital Triplet for a three-floor elevator system. It demonstrates the integration of a machine learning (ML) object detection model and the system Digital Twin. This was done to introduce an additional security feature that enabled the system to make a decision, based on objects detected and take preliminary security measures. The virtual model was designed in Siemens NX and programmed via Total Integrated Automation (TIA) portal software. The corresponding physical model was fabricated and controlled using a Programmable Logic Controller (PLC) S7 1200. A control program was developed to mimic the general operations of a typical elevator system used in a commercial building setting. Communication, between the physical and virtual models, was enabled using the OPC-Unified Architecture (OPC-UA) protocol. Object recognition using “You only look once” (YOLOV3) based machine learning algorithm was incorporated. The Digital Triplet’s functionality was tested, ensuring the virtual system duplicated actual operations of the physical counterpart through the use of sensor data. Performance testing was done to determine the impact of the ML module on the real-time functionality aspect of the system. Experiment results showed the object recognition contributed an average of 1.083s to an overall signal travel time of 1.338 s

    A deliberative model for self-adaptation middleware using architectural dependency

    Get PDF
    A crucial prerequisite to externalized adaptation is an understanding of how components are interconnected, or more particularly how and why they depend on one another. Such dependencies can be used to provide an architectural model, which provides a reference point for externalized adaptation. In this paper, it is described how dependencies are used as a basis to systems' self-understanding and subsequent architectural reconfigurations. The approach is based on the combination of: instrumentation services, a dependency meta-model and a system controller. In particular, the latter uses self-healing repair rules (or conflict resolution strategies), based on extensible beliefs, desires and intention (EBDI) model, to reflect reconfiguration changes back to a target application under examination

    Development Of An SMS Based Alert Systemusing Object Oriented Design Concept

    Get PDF
    An automated lecture alert management system has been developed using java programming concept knownfor its portability. This backend system was interfaced with the GSM network through USB port of a PC and GSM modem. The desktop SMS application was developed using C# programming language. It generates updates and reminder from a time schedule stored in a database thereby making the system a time triggered application

    VPOET: Using a Distributed Collaborative Platform for Semantic Web Applications

    Get PDF
    This paper describes a distributed collaborative wiki-based platform that has been designed to facilitate the development of Semantic Web applications. The applications designed using this platform are able to build semantic data through the cooperation of different developers and to exploit that semantic data. The paper shows a practical case study on the application VPOET, and how an application based on Google Gadgets has been designed to test VPOET and let human users exploit the semantic data created. This practical example can be used to show how different Semantic Web technologies can be integrated into a particular Web application, and how the knowledge can be cooperatively improved.Comment: accepted for the 2nd International Symposium on Intelligent Distributed Computing - IDC'2008. September 18-20, 2008, Catania, Ital

    An Automated WSDL Generation and Enhanced SOAP Message Processing System for Mobile Web Services

    Get PDF
    Web services are key applications in business-to-business, business-to-customer, and enterprise applications integration solutions. As the mobile Internet becomes one of the main methods for information delivery, mobile Web Services are regarded as a critical aspect of e-business architecture. In this paper, we proposed a mobile Web Services middleware that converts conventional Internet services into mobile Web services. We implemented a WSDL (Web Service Description Language) builder that converts HTML/XML into WSDL and a SAOP (Simple Object Access Protocol) message processor. The former minimizes the overhead cost of rebuilding mobile Web Services and enables seamless services between wired and wireless Internet services. The latter enhances SOAP processing performance by eliminating the Servlet container (Tomcat), a required component of typical Web services implementation. Our system can completely support standard Web Services protocol, minimizing communication overhead, message processing time, and server overload. Finally we compare our empirical results with those of typical Web Service

    A framework for requirements engineering for context-aware services

    Get PDF
    Context-aware services, especially when made available to mobile devices, constitute an interesting but very challenging domain. It poses fundamental problems for both requirements engineering, software architecture, and their relationship. We propose a novel, reflection-based framework for requirements engineering for this class of applications. The framework addresses the key difficulties in this field, such as changing context and changing requirements. We report preliminary work on this framework and suggest future directions

    Towards a UML profile for modeling WAP applications

    Get PDF
    UML (Unified Modeling Language) is one of the most used languages to specify and document informatics applications. However, UML is a generalpurpose language, so it often lacks of elements to model and represent concrete concepts of specifics domains. As a solution, OMG (Object Management Group) has created the profiles, a mechanism to extend the syntax and semantics of UML to express more specific concepts of certain application domains. In this work we present a UML profile for modeling WAP (Wireless Applications Protocol) applications. The main goal of the proposed profile is to extend UML to provide specifics elements (labeled classes, stereotypes, tagged values and constraints) that allow software developers to modelWAP applications. The expressiveness of the UML diagrams allows modeling important stages of the process of common applications; nevertheless, the modeling process of WAP applications is still a too specific domain that can be hardly dealt with in its entirety without extending the language. In the process exists navigational, design and construction issues that cannot be modeled using the traditional elements of UML. However, by using the specific elements created by the proposed profile, these issues can be completely solved, and even a greater expressiveness can be obtained.Facultad de Informátic
    • …
    corecore